Hidden Networks

Hidden beneath floors and behind walls, your plumbing system works silently until something goes wrong. Professional inspections bring visibility to these concealed components through specialized tools like video cameras that travel through pipes, revealing conditions invisible from the outside. This technology allows plumbers to spot tree root intrusions, pipe deterioration, or accumulating debris before complete blockages occur.

Leak Hunters

Small leaks waste surprising amounts of water while gradually damaging surrounding structures. During inspections, plumbers check fixtures, connections, and visible pipes for moisture signs indicating developing problems. They measure water pressure throughout the home, identifying imbalances that strain pipes and appliances. These preventative checks save water and prevent the mold growth that often accompanies persistent moisture issues.

Clog Prevention

Slow-moving drains indicate developing clogs that will eventually stop water flow completely. Professional inspections include drain assessments that identify buildup before total blockages form. Many drain issues can be resolved with simple cleaning during inspection visits, preventing emergency calls later. This proactive approach maintains proper water flow throughout your plumbing system.

Heater Maintenance

Water heaters require regular inspection to perform efficiently and safely. Professional evaluations include checking temperature settings, examining safety mechanisms, and testing pressure relief valves. Inspectors remove sediment that reduces heating efficiency and shortens equipment life. These maintenance steps extend water heater lifespan while reducing energy consumption.

Fixture Checks

Toilets, faucets, and showers experience constant use and eventual wear. Comprehensive plumbing inspections examine every fixture for proper operation, water-saving performance, and potential replacement requirements. Small adjustments during inspection visits often restore proper function while preventing wasted water through continuous leaks or improper operation.

Weather Preparation

Different seasons bring varied plumbing challenges, from frozen pipes in winter to increased irrigation demands in summer. Scheduled inspections address seasonal concerns before problems develop. Fall inspections prepare outdoor plumbing for winter temperatures, while spring evaluations ensure systems remain undamaged after cold months. This calendar-based approach protects your plumbing year-round.

Problem Prediction

Experienced plumbers recognize signs of developing issues that might not cause immediate problems but will eventually require attention. During inspections, they can provide timelines for recommended maintenance or replacement, allowing homeowners to budget appropriately rather than facing unexpected expenses. This planning aspect helps prioritize plumbing investments wisely.
